Recently, Walmart reiterated its commitment to North American manufacturing, specifically mentioning 44 companies located in Arkansas who produce 73 brands and 1,700 items currently stocked in their stores. A company representative stated that “the economics of manufacturing [overseas] is changing.” During the next decade, Walmart is investing $50 billion to promote U.S.-made products, offering longer contracts to U.S. suppliers so they can invest in their facilities.
